What Affects Mold Remediation Costs in Mumford?

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ises

📊

labor costs

Labor rates in Robertson County tend to be more competitive than in major metro areas like Houston or Dallas. However, because Mumford is a smaller town, some mold remediation specialists may charge travel fees if they're coming from outside the immediate area. Getting multiple local quotes helps you understand the baseline labor cost for your project.

📊

market dynamics

The mold remediation market in rural Central Texas is shaped by a limited number of specialized contractors. Demand typically spikes after heavy rain seasons or flooding events, which can push prices higher temporarily. Homes with crawlspaces, older foundations, or past water damage history may see higher quotes due to complexity.

📊

seasonal trends

East Texas humidity means mold issues can happen year-round, but pricing often fluctuates with the seasons. Spring and fall tend to be busier for remediation as humidity levels rise and fall. Late summer and early fall can see increased demand following heavy rains, so scheduling during slower months may give you more negotiating room.

🧱 Key Pricing Components

  • Inspection and testing fees (often a separate cost from remediation)
  • Labor for containment setup, removal, and disposal of affected materials
  • HEPA vacuuming, air scrubbing, and professional-grade equipment
  • Material replacement or repair of drywall, insulation, flooring, or framing
  • Post-remediation clearance testing to verify the mold is gone
  • Travel or mobilization fees for contractors coming from outside Mumford

How to Save Money on Mold Remediation

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ying

🗣️

Tip

Get at least 3 written quotes from licensed mold remediation contractors serving Mumford and Robertson County.

🗣️

Tip

Make sure each quote includes a scope of work, not just a flat price — you want to know what's being removed, cleaned, and replaced.

🗣️

Tip

Ask if the quote includes post-remediation testing. A clearance test is your proof that the mold is gone.

🗣️

Tip

Confirm if travel or mobilization fees are included. Some contractors charge extra for reaching rural properties.

⚠️ Watch Out For

Pricing Red Flags

Warning Sign

A quote that's significantly lower than others without a clear explanation — this often means cutting corners on containment or disposal.

Warning Sign

Contractors who demand a large upfront payment (50% or more) before any work begins. Reputable pros typically ask for a deposit of 10-30%.

Warning Sign

Pressure to sign immediately with claims of 'this price won't last' or 'mold spreads fast.' A trustworthy contractor will let you take time to decide.

Warning Sign

Quotes that don't include a written scope of work or mention of post-remediation verification testing.

Pricing Questions

Common questions about mold remediation costs in Mumford

💬 Does homeowners insurance cover mold remediation in Mumford, TX?

Coverage varies by policy. Many Texas homeowners insurance policies exclude mold damage unless it's caused by a covered peril (like a burst pipe). It's best to check with your insurance provider and get clear documentation of what's covered before starting work.

💬 How do I know if a mold remediation company in Mumford is licensed?

Texas does not have a statewide mold remediation license, but the Texas Department of State Health Services (DSHS) regulates mold assessment and remediation. Look for contractors who follow DSHS guidelines and carry general liability insurance. Professional certifications from the IICRC are also a strong sign of quality.

💬 Do I need a permit for mold remediation in Robertson County?

Mold remediation itself typically doesn't require a county permit. However, if the work involves significant structural repairs, electrical changes, or new construction, permits may be needed. Your contractor should be able to advise you based on the scope of work.

💬 Can I remove mold myself instead of hiring a professional?

Very small patches (under 10 square feet) may be cleanable with proper safety precautions. Larger infestations, hidden mold, or mold from sewage or floodwater should always be handled by a professional due to health risks and the need for proper containment and disposal.

💬 What size mold problem is considered an emergency?

Mold caused by active water intrusion, sewage backups, or flooding is often treated as urgent. If you can see mold spreading rapidly, smell musty odors throughout the home, or have family members with respiratory issues, don't wait — get professional quotes right away.

💬 Is post-remediation testing really necessary?

Yes. A clearance test provides independent verification that the mold has been properly removed and that spore levels are back to normal. It protects both you and the contractor and gives you peace of mind that the problem is truly resolved.
